Class Number: 1545
Description: Hours: Three hours lecture in the lab per week Prerequisites: MATH 300 Study of the relation of languages (i.e. sets of strings) and machines for processing these languages, with emphasis on classes of languages and corresponding classes of machines. Phrase structure languages and grammar. Types of grammars and classes of languages. Regular languages and finite state automata. Context-free languages and pushdown automata. Unrestricted languages and Turing Machines. Computability models of Turing, Church, Markov, and McCarthy. Applications to programming languages, compiler design, and program design and testing.

Info has been updated in the last 30 minutes
Days Time Date Range Location Instructor
ARR 08/25/2008 - 12/13/2008 Online Peter Smith
Status: Open
Session: Regular Academic Session
Units: 3.00
Class Components: Lecture
Career: Undergraduate
Start Date: 08/25/2008
End Date: 12/13/2008
Grading: Letter Grade

Class Availability

Information below is 24 hours old.
Enrollment Total: 22
Available Seats: 3
Wait List Capacity: 10
Wait List Total: 0


Enrollment Information

  • Upper Division


Notes

  • On-line course
  • Instructor to contact student by e-mail, obtain an e-mail account at: http://mail.dolphin.csuci.edu
Back to Top ↑